Trip Overview

The drive from Gary, IN to Taylor, IN covers 97.7 miles and takes about 2h 3m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.

The route leans on Casimir Pulaski Memorial Highway, North River Road, US 52 for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is turn-heavy local dr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 79.5 miles on Casimir Pulaski Memorial Highway. At current regular gas prices, budget about $15.27 one way before food or hotel costs.
